MIRAMAR, Fla., (December 8, 2015) - Spirit Airlines (NASDAQ: SAVE) today reported its preliminary traffic results for November 2015.

Traffic (revenue passenger miles) in November 2015 increased 27.8 percent versus November 2014 on a capacity (available seat miles) increase of 28.2 percent. Load factor for November 2015 was 81.9 percent, a decrease of 0.2 percentage points compared to November 2014. Spirit's preliminary systemwide completion factor for November 2015 was 99.1 percent.
